What is Zero-Knowledge Proof?

Zero-Knowledge Proof (ZKP) is a cryptographic method that allows one party (the prover) to demonstrate to another party (the verifier) that they possess certain information without revealing the actual information itself. This concept is rooted in the idea of proving knowledge without disclosure, ensuring privacy and security in digital transactions. ZKP acquisitions refer to the adoption, integration, and utilization of Zero-Knowledge Proofs in various systems and applications.

For example, imagine proving you know the password to a secure system without actually sharing the password. ZKP enables this by creating a mathematical proof that verifies your knowledge without exposing the sensitive data. This revolutionary approach is particularly valuable in industries like finance, healthcare, and blockchain, where data privacy is paramount.

Real-World Use Cases of Zero-Knowledge Proof Acquisitions

  1. Blockchain Transactions: ZKP is widely used in blockchain to verify transactions without revealing the sender, receiver, or amount. For instance, Zcash employs ZKP to ensure private cryptocurrency transactions.
  2. Identity Verification: ZKP enables secure authentication processes, such as proving age or citizenship without disclosing personal details.
  3. Healthcare Data Sharing: Hospitals and research institutions use ZKP to share patient data securely for collaborative studies without violating privacy laws.
  4. Secure Voting Systems: ZKP ensures the integrity of electronic voting by verifying voter eligibility without exposing their identity or vote.
  5. Fraud Detection: Financial institutions leverage ZKP to detect fraudulent activities without compromising customer data.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

  1. Complexity: ZKP algorithms can be difficult to understand and implement. Solution: Invest in training and hire experts in cryptography.
  2. Computational Overhead: ZKP may require significant computational resources. Solution: Use optimized protocols like zk-STARKs for better efficiency.
  3. Scalability Issues: Large-scale applications may face scalability challenges. Solution: Implement layer-2 solutions or hybrid models.
  4. Regulatory Barriers: Navigating compliance requirements can be challenging. Solution: Work with legal experts to ensure adherence to regulations.
  5. Adoption Resistance: Stakeholders may resist adopting new technologies. Solution: Educate stakeholders on the benefits and ROI of ZKP acquisitions.

Example 1: ZKP in Blockchain Transactions

Blockchain platforms like Zcash use ZKP to enable private cryptocurrency transactions. By employing zk-SNARKs, Zcash ensures that transaction details remain confidential while still verifying their validity.
